Catalog description

This research course allows the student to explore a topic of interest in medical physics under the close supervision of a faculty member who has agreed to direct the student's work. The course may include directed readings, assisting the faculty member with a research project, carrying out an independent research project, or other activities deemed appropriate. Prereq: Physics 1250 and 1251, or equiv. Repeatable to a maximum of 20 cr hrs or 10 completions. This course is graded S/U.
